Aston Villa beat Bristol City 5-0 back in January and Lee Johnson was not impressed.

Bristol City boss Lee Johnson’s comments about Aston Villa back in January now look embarrassing.

Johnson was frustrated with the Villa Park crowd, who taunted his side, when Villa thrashed them 5-0.

At that stage, Bristol City were ahead of Villa in the Championship table, and Johnson suggested that his side would have the last laugh.

“It was interesting to hear the Villa fans mocking us, Bruce flicking the ball all over the gaff – we’re still three points above them. Let’s see where we are at the end,” he said to the Birmingham Mail.

However, the comments have backfired on Johnson now, as Bristol City have collapsed while Villa have got stronger.

Villa are currently in fourth place in the Championship table, and are sure to be in the play offs this season.

Johnson’s side, on the other hand, have slipped all the way out of the top six, and now look rank outsiders to claim a play off place.

The Robins have fallen down to 10th place in the Championship table, 16 points behind Villa.

And Johnson is surely regretting making the comments he did about Steve Bruce’s men back in January now.
